    Nobody is up there in October. I've been up around the same time of year and you have the mountain to yourself. Granted, there are no flowers, colorful vistas, or chances to get water (higher on the Timpooneke side anyway).

    We went up the Timpooneke trail. We saw maybe 10 people on the trail. One was an elderly gentleman who was on his 50th climb to the top. He was 80 something and flew up the mountain! I was impressed. It was a perfect day to hike.
